Coil springs are the part of your vehicle’s suspension system that provide support, stability, and cushioning as you drive over bumps, potholes, and uneven terrain. They’re coils of steel that are flexible and firm, whose coil number “N” depends on how much weight they can handle. Although leaf springs have become massively popular in modern trucks, SUVs, and other passenger cars, coil springs are favored in some performance applications.

How Do I Know If My Car Coil Spring Is Bad?

A compromised suspension system becomes noticeable once your ride comfort has deteriorated from what you were accustomed to. In particular, for coil springs, your vehicle will tend to sag, lean, or sway excessively especially when it’s fully loaded. Other symptoms to look out for are excessive tire wear, increased noise from the corners of your vehicle when driving rough roads, and rust or corrosion on the springs.
